چکیده

As various types of smart devices have recently appeared, SNS (Social Networking Services) have been expanded. Thus, the demand for social media streaming is on the rise. In the previous study, a media conversion system for ensuring QoS (Quality of service) of media streaming was presented. The presented system implemented a distributed streaming environment with multiple servers in order to perform reliable streaming of converted media. The method of distributing streaming job is crucial in implementing a distributed environment. Thus, the presented system established distributed streaming servers that applied RR (Round Robin) and LC (Least Connection) algorithms. However, since systems that applied RR and LC do not consider CPU utilization rate and network transmission traffic, they have limitations on reducing the burdens of servers. This study will present a SRC (Streaming Resource-based Connection) scheduling algorithm for ensuring QoS in the distributed streaming environment. The focus of this SRC algorithm considering CPU utilization rate and transmission traffic of servers is resolving the limitations of existing algorithms. As a performance evaluation, utilization rate of different systems that each applied SRC, RR and LC will be compared.
